13/*
14Driver: pcm3724
15Description: Advantech PCM-3724
16Author: Drew Csillag <drew_csillag@yahoo.com>
17Devices: [Advantech] PCM-3724 (pcm724)
18Status: tested
19
20This is driver for digital I/O boards PCM-3724 with 48 DIO.
21It needs 8255.o for operations and only immediate mode is supported.
22See the source for configuration details.
23
24Copy/pasted/hacked from pcm724.c
25*/

119static int compute_buffer(int config, int devno, struct comedi_subdevice *s)
120{
121	/* 1 in io_bits indicates output */
122	if (s->io_bits & 0x0000ff) {
123		if (devno == 0) {
124			config |= BUF_A0;
125		} else {
126			config |= BUF_A1;
127		}
128	}
129	if (s->io_bits & 0x00ff00) {
130		if (devno == 0) {
131			config |= BUF_B0;
132		} else {
133			config |= BUF_B1;
134		}
135	}
136	if (s->io_bits & 0xff0000) {
137		if (devno == 0) {
138			config |= BUF_C0;
139		} else {
140			config |= BUF_C1;
141		}
142	}
143	return config;
144}
145
146static void do_3724_config(struct comedi_device *dev, struct comedi_subdevice *s,
147	int chanspec)
148{
149	int config;
150	int buffer_config;
151	unsigned long port_8255_cfg;
152
153	config = CR_CW;
154	buffer_config = 0;
155
156	/* 1 in io_bits indicates output, 1 in config indicates input */
157	if (!(s->io_bits & 0x0000ff)) {
158		config |= CR_A_IO;
159	}
160	if (!(s->io_bits & 0x00ff00)) {
161		config |= CR_B_IO;
162	}
163	if (!(s->io_bits & 0xff0000)) {
164		config |= CR_C_IO;
165	}
166
167	buffer_config = compute_buffer(0, 0, dev->subdevices);
168	buffer_config = compute_buffer(buffer_config, 1, (dev->subdevices) + 1);
169
170	if (s == dev->subdevices) {
171		port_8255_cfg = dev->iobase + _8255_CR;
172	} else {
173		port_8255_cfg = dev->iobase + SIZE_8255 + _8255_CR;
174	}
175	outb(buffer_config, dev->iobase + 8);	/* update buffer register */
176	/* printk("pcm3724 buffer_config (%lx) %d, %x\n", dev->iobase + _8255_CR, chanspec, buffer_config); */
177	outb(config, port_8255_cfg);
178}
179
180static void enable_chan(struct comedi_device *dev, struct comedi_subdevice *s, int chanspec)
181{
182	unsigned int mask;
183	int gatecfg;
184	struct priv_pcm3724 *priv;
185
186	gatecfg = 0;
187	priv = (struct priv_pcm3724 *) (dev->private);
188
189	mask = 1 << CR_CHAN(chanspec);
190	if (s == dev->subdevices) {	/*  subdev 0 */
191		priv->dio_1 |= mask;
192	} else {		/* subdev 1 */
193		priv->dio_2 |= mask;
194	}
195	if (priv->dio_1 & 0xff0000) {
196		gatecfg |= GATE_C0;
197	}
198	if (priv->dio_1 & 0xff00) {
199		gatecfg |= GATE_B0;
200	}
201	if (priv->dio_1 & 0xff) {
202		gatecfg |= GATE_A0;
203	}
204	if (priv->dio_2 & 0xff0000) {
205		gatecfg |= GATE_C1;
206	}
207	if (priv->dio_2 & 0xff00) {
208		gatecfg |= GATE_B1;
209	}
210	if (priv->dio_2 & 0xff) {
211		gatecfg |= GATE_A1;
212	}
213	/*       printk("gate control %x\n", gatecfg); */
214	outb(gatecfg, dev->iobase + 9);
215}
